Peer reviewedSignell, Karl – Music Educators Journal, 1980
Each of the major music cultures in West Asia--Turkey, Persia, and the Arab countries--has distinct rules of improvisation. Improvisation in each of these countries is described; a glossary is included; selected readings and recordings conclude the article. (KC)

Doolittle, Martha – Online Submission, 2009
A survey given to Austin Independent School District teachers and campus administrators in spring 2009 showed several commonly requested training topics, such as motivating students; knowledge of technology, resources, and materials; differentiated instruction; and managing student behavior.
